Elizabeth Bartlet Westin

Summary

Elizabeth Bartlet Westin is a fictional human[1].

Key Facts

  • Elizabeth Bartlet Westin's father was Josiah Bartlet[2].
  • Elizabeth Bartlet Westin's mother was Abbey Bartlet[3].
  • Elizabeth Bartlet Westin was married to Doug Westin[4].
  • Elizabeth Bartlet Westin held citizenship in United States[5].
  • Elizabeth Bartlet Westin is recorded as female[6].
